Fix order of callbacks

Delivery comes before inbound. The order of the URLs was jumbled in two
places:
- in the view function
- in the Jinja template

So as the user saw it the URLs were in the right order, because the
double jumbling cancelled itself out. But it made the code _really_
confusing to read.
